#Revati #Nakshatra - Revati is the twenty-seventh Nakshatra in #Vedic #astrology ranging from 16°40' to 30° Meena.

Symbol - The symbol of this Nakshatra is #fish, often a #pair of fish.

Astronomical Name - The astronomical name of this Nakshatra is ζ #Piscium.

Deity of Nakshatra - #Pushan, the nurturer and protector of travelers and animals is the deity of Revati Nakshatra.

Ruling Planet - Revati Nakshatra is ruled by Budh (the planet #Mercury).

Others - Revati Nakshatra is Mridu or #soft in #nature. When Revati has the most influence, it is best to begin working on things of physical beauty like #music and #jewellery.

About Revati Nakshatra
Known as the “Wealthy Constellation”, Revati Nakshatra is the twenty-seventh Nakshatra in the series of lunar constellations. It is the apex of all the zodiac energies, especially Mercurian energy. Revati Nakshatra is represented by the group of faint stars lying in the Pisces constellation. These stars form the shape of a “Dhola”, a drum with strings across the neck with a strap and played with both hands. In Modern astronomy, the brightest stars among the faint stars are referred to as Zeta- Piscium. This star is positioned on the planetary ecliptic which makes it easily locatable in the new moon night.

Etymologically, Revati means “the wealthy”. It speaks of the association of the Revati Nakshatra with wealth and opulence. Its alternative meaning is “to transcend” or “to go beyond”. Since Revati is the final Nakshatra of the constellation series, this signifies the end of a cycle or a gateway between one and another cycle. Astrologers considered Revati star as “the constellation of transition”. As per scriptures, this Nakshatra is slow in activity because of impending change that is envisaged to it.

Symbolized by the “a fish swimming in the sea”, Revati Nakshatra is apparently associated with the zodiac sign Pisces. It shows two fishes swimming in opposite directions. This symbolism signifies the journey of the soul in the celestial waters. Lord Vishnu is often linked with the celestial waters due to the portrayal of Lord Vishnu sitting on the Vasuki at the top of the celestial ocean (Sheer Sagar, the sea of consciousness). Alternatively, this symbolism also speaks of one’s path such as the path to salvation, the path to one’s house, the whole life path and path of spiritual awakening.

Revati Nakshatra is attuned to collective consciousness unlike the mass consciousness represented by the Cancer zodiac sign. It allows the natives to connect with the Universal mind with a set of shared beliefs, ideas, and morals. The Nakshatra speaks of Moksha or final enlightenment which is shown with its last position in the constellation chart. The symbol “drum” speaks of the commencement of news. In ancient times, drums were used for communicating news and thus the Revati constellation is linked with attributes to communicate and express well.

The presiding deity of the Revati constellation, Pooshan or Pushan or Poosha is a solar deity. He is depicted as the God standing at the beginning of all the paths and beginning. He is linked with safe travel and is supposed to have the power to light up all the paths. He is related to travel of all kinds such as mental, casual, emotional, astral and physical. He is known as a softer solar deity who bestows wealth, prosperity and fulfillment to its natives. Alternatively, Lord Vishnu is seen as the overseer of Revati Nakshatra. Lord Vishnu is the preserver of the Universe and the one of the Trinity Gods. He is the husband of Goddess Laxmi, the deity of wealth and prosperity (again associating Revati with attributes- wealth and richness). The depiction of Lord Vishnu and Goddess Lakshmi over the ocean of Universal waters is the imagery of this Nakshatra.

Revati Nakshatra is correlated to the universal point where after the completion process, the material and astral realm are drawn into the causal realm and then the casual realm into a supreme eternal void. Revati star is also associated with the seventh Sacral center, “Sahastrara”, which is achieved after the awakening of Kundalini. In a lesser evolved aspect, the Revati asterism is linked with the “ocean of illusion”, corresponding to Manipura Chakra, the third sacral center governing all the worldly and materialistic actions.

As per Vedic Astrology, Jupiter, Mercury, Venus and Moon in Revati tend to offer favorable results. Ketu placement in this Nakshatra is good for spiritual pursuits. Moon in Revati Nakshatra offers perfect body, good luck, purity, wealth and heroic countenance to the Revati Nakshatra men and women.

Revati deals with the infinity of time, space and everything else. Its main keyword is “summation”. Their ability to understand and see every other Nakshatra is exemplary. In the Universal scheme of things, this constellation is associated with “Kshiradyapani Shakti”. This is the ability to nourish through milk. Its symbolism depicts cows above and calves below. The imagery focuses on the nourishment and sustainable aspect of the Revati constellation.

Revati Nakshatra in English is referred to as Revati. Revati Nakshatra in Tamil is referred to as Revathi Natchathiram (ரேவதி நட்சத்திரம்). The name of Revati Nakshatra in Malayalam is Revathy Nakshatra (രേവതി നക്ഷത്ര) while the name of the Revati constellation in Telugu is Revati (రేవతి).

About Anuradha Nakshatra
Known as “the Star of Success”, Anuradha is the 17th Nakshatra in the series of 27 Nakshatras. It is the group of three stars forming the shape of “a staff”. The names of three stars in Western astronomy are - Beta Scorpionis, Delta Scorpionis (Isidis) and Pi-Scorpionis. All these stars lie at the beginning of the Scorpio #constellation and can be easily spotted in the dark night sky from the terrain.

Etymologically, the word Anuradha means “Another Radha” or “After Radha”. It is closely linked with the asterism Radha (Vishakha) and despite any clear similarity, Vishakha is paired with star Anuradha like Purva Phalguni and Uttara Phalguni Nakshatra. Alternatively, the name of the Anuradha constellation refers to “Subsequent success”. It indicates the chances of finding fame and success by Anuradha star natives in their later life with hard work and devotion.

Symbolized by the staff, the Anuradha constellation represents power and protection. It also signifies wisdom, learning and close association with the Universal forces. Anuradha star is also symbolized by the “lotus” representing purity, auspiciousness, knowledge and enlightenment. It shows the attainment of knowledge through intellectual, mental and emotional upheavals. The alternative symbol of Anuradha Nakshatra is a “triumphant gateway adorned with leaves”. It speaks of victory and attainment of goals through group and collaborative activities.

Mitra is the presiding deity of the Anuradha star. He is one of the twelve Adityas (solar deities) and God of friendships, good faith and warmth. He is associated with the light of the dawn and invoked along either with Varuna (the deity of Shatabhisha) or Aryaman (The Uttara Phalguni Nakshatra Lord). Mitra offers an optimistic view to Anuradha star natives and infuses qualities of lightheartedness, leadership and helpfulness to them.

Anuradha is the ruling Nakshatra of the science of Numerology. Its numerical potency of 17 in Numerology is seen as a medium to bring celestial energies to the earth. It decodes the secret working of the Universe and relates to the movement of Kundalini through Chakras (seven sacral centers). Anuradha is the first star where the exploration of Chakras occurs on the full scale to bestow fruits and get access to the functioning of the Universe.

Anuradha is the star that strikes harmony and understanding in all the forms of existence. It befriends the Universal energies and makes everyone work together even if they are enemies. This Nakshatra is associated with learning and accumulation of Knowledge and thence Goddess Saraswati can be also said to be connected with the Anuradha constellation.

Anuradha Nakshatra in English is referred to as Anuradha/ Anuraadhaa. Anuradha Nakshatra in Tamil is referred to as Anusam Natchathiram (அனுஷம் நட்சத்திரம்). The name of Anuradha Nakshatra in Malayalam is Anizham Nakshatra (അനിഴം നക്ഷത്ര) and the name of the Anuradha constellation in Telugu is Anuradha (అనురాధ).

About Chitra Nakshatra
Chitra Nakshatra is the fourteenth and brightest Nakshatra of the zodiac that can be seen naked from the eyes in the sky. This is one of the few stars that are depicted by a single star. Referred to as the “Star of opportunity”, the Chitra star lies in the lower portion of the Virgo constellation. It was seen as the residence of “ #Tvashtar” or Vishwakarma by the ancient Vedic seers.

As per Etymology, the word Chitra in English means “Glittering”, “Brilliant”, “Bright”, “Beautiful” “Visually Exciting” and “Illusory”. It speaks of craftsmanship and the primary objective of surmounting illusion and Maya. In Vedic texts, Chitra Nakshatra is referred to as the Nakshatra of prosperity and abundance.

The main symbol of Chitra Nakshatra is a “big, bright and shining jewel”. It indicates that like the gemstones are formed after passing them through the intense and extreme heat and pressure, likewise, the Universe needs to progress from the initial Big Bang. The alternative symbol of Chitra Nakshatra is “the Pearl''. It signifies the irritation and depression that occurs during the creation of something artistic. In its higher aspect, the Chitra denotes the vision to see beyond illusion, helping to attain the pearl of knowledge.

Lord Vishwakarma is the presiding deity of Chitra Nakshatra. He is the divine architect who is also referred to as Tvastar in Vedic texts. According to scriptures, Vishwakarma creates, mutates and shapes new forms with his knowledge of Maya. His works are mysterious and seem to be magical. He creates magnificent things and is friendly to all the other Gods.

He creates worlds for all the races (demonic, godly, human, serpent etc.) and possesses duality in his characteristics. These traits are significant in Chitra Nakshatra and hence it's difficult to classify Chitra Star in the category of good, evil, crooked or saint.

Chitra is the architect of the Universe and hence associated with Lord Brahma, the creator God among Trinity. It connects Virgo and Libra and thus creates a bridge between compassion and harmony. In Numerology, the number 14 of Chitra Nakshatra speaks of Temperance whereas in the Universal scheme of things, it associates with “Punya Chayani Shakti”. It denotes the power to gather merit and symbolizes truth below and law above. It means that children born in Chitra Nakshatra gain respect and merit through hard work, following the laws of the Universe.

Chitra Nakshatra in English is referred to as Chitra. Chitra Nakshatra in Tamil is referred to as Chittirai Natchathiram (சித்திரை நட்சத்திரம்). The name of Chitra Nakshatra in Malayalam is Chithira Nakshatra (ചിത്തിര നക്ഷത്ര) and the name of Chitra constellation in Telugu is Chitta (చిత్).

About Mrigashirsha Nakshatra
Etymologically, the word Mrigashirsha Nakshatra means the head of Deer. It is the fifth Nakshatra out of 27 Nakshatras. Mrigashirsha is also referred to by names such as “Saumya'' which means benevolent, “Chandra or Udupa” meaning The Moon and “Arghayani” meaning the commencement of the year. Ruled by the Moon, Mrigashirsha God, the Nakshatra represents the galactic firmament by a bright star and three pale stars in the Orion constellation.

Mrigashirsha is presided over by the cosmic intelligence of Soma which signifies an immortal drink. It exhibits a soft nature and is thus referred to by scholars as “Saumya”. As per Vedic astrology, the main Mrigashirsha Nakshatra characteristic and functioning can be summed up as “Quest”. It offers seeking quality and allows one to find one’s life path or destiny.

Goddess Parvati, the consort of Lord #Shiva is the presiding deity of Mrigashirsha Nakshatra. It is believed that she was in a quest in her adulthood for an ideal spouse which was Lord Shiva. According to planetary principles, the positive node Rahu is also associated with Mrigashirsha constellation It offers the quality to search for life’s purpose and attain enlightenment.

Mrigashirsha Nakshatra in English is referred to as Mrigashirsha/ #Mrigashira. Whereas, Mrigashirsha Nakshatra in Tamil is referred to as Mirugasiridam Natchathiram ( மிருகசீரிடம நட்சத்திரம்), the name of Mrigashirsha Nakshatra in Malayalam is Makayiram Nakshatra (മകയിരം നക്ഷത്ര) and name of Mrigashirsha Nakshatra in Telugu is #Mrigasira (మృగశిర).
